As of now popular consensus in the RC community is basically that you can fly, you can film, but you can't in any way profit from it as far as Federal law is concerned, but it is a bit of a grey area whether or not they have any control over airspace under 400' AGL to begin with.
However, post them to YouTube with monitization turned off and, barring any local laws making it illegal, you are in the clear.
